High Dive is seeking an experienced General Manager to lead the daily operations of one of Birmingham’s most distinctive hospitality and entertainment concepts.
Designed around an acoustically engineered, high-fidelity listening experience, High Dive brings together food, beverage, live music, DJ programming, and outdoor entertainment.
The broader campus includes a 600-person standing-capacity amphitheater, national acts, recurring jazz and DJ programming, food trucks, retail tenants, and additional guest experiences.
This is an opportunity for a confident, hands-on hospitality leader to help shape a growing concept while delivering an exceptional experience for every guest and team member.
The Opportunity
Reporting to the Director of Operations, the General Manager will oversee the full operation and serve as the connection between senior leadership and the operating team.
The GM will directly lead approximately four managers and shift leaders—including the Beverage Manager and Kitchen Manager—who collectively oversee a team of approximately 25 employees.
This is a highly visible role for a leader who thrives on the floor, sets a clear plan for every shift, and knows how to align people, labor, and resources with the needs of the business.
What You’ll Do
- Own daily operations across food, beverage, dining room service, outdoor activity, and event programming
- Lead, develop, and hold accountable the Beverage Manager, Kitchen Manager, shift leaders, and broader operating team
- Build schedules based on forecasted business, labor budgets, and sales-per-labor-hour expectations
- Manage controllable costs, including food, beverage, supplies, waste, and labor
- Monitor operational KPIs and provide consistent reporting to leadership
- Set a clear plan for each shift and position team members according to anticipated and real-time business needs
- Drive consistent execution of established culinary, hospitality, safety, and operational systems
- Maintain a strong floor presence and step into the areas where leadership is most needed
- Build a culture of communication, accountability, development, retention, and genuine hospitality
- Partner with leadership to refine High Dive’s operating systems and standards as the concept continues to grow
